// Matchline's pairing service hit 400ms GC pauses under Tuesday's load spike.
// Root cause: oversized object churn in the candidate-scoring loop. Fixed by
// pooling score buffers; pauses now under 20ms at p99. Release manager: hold
// the 4.2 cut until soak finishes Friday. Client below talks to the internal
// scoring gateway and authenticates with the key that follows.

API key for yahig-tadup: kto7_ubizbYm

Attendees: Heads of Department; chaired by Tomas Rell.

We agreed to retire the Fennwick Classic line by end of next fiscal year. Sales will run a final-stock push through the Hartvale channel; support commitments honored for 18 months after last sale. Marketing to draft customer comms by month-end — keep it upbeat, not funereal. Manufacturing winds down the Osberg facility line in two phases. Parts inventory gets liquidated, not scrapped. Questions to Tomas. The reasoning behind the timing is summarized below.

board note of bawep-tajef: Queniusek Systems plans to raise the Quenvan list price by 53.1 percent in March. The pricing group signed off on a budget of $176.4 million for Project Drueth. The renewal with Casionix Partners closes at $142.5 million a year, 8.3 percent below the last contract. Project Fraax slips by six weeks because of the tooling delay.

**Q: DeployDot stopped answering status queries in the on-call channel — what now?**

A: First restart the bot via the Larkspur control panel. If it still fails auth against the pipeline API, its token store is likely sealed and must be manually unsealed. This only happens after a host migration. Unsealing requires the recovery passphrase, provided below.

unlock words, yawig-kagef: gordor-holvan-ulaael-pramir-ulaiel-tamdor

Subject: Key rotation — queue migration

All,

We finished cutting over from the homegrown Stacker queue to FlowRail. Old Stacker credentials are revoked as of today. Update any scripts hitting the dispatch endpoint before Thursday's sync. Ping me with breakage. The new FlowRail service key is below.

gateway credential: kto23_LX9A4ys6i4nzHtpOLNLodKK